Obama's Not Quite Ready for Equality


Although Barack Obama has not been President more than a few weeks, I see a pattern emerging. He is not willing to take a strong leadership role to take a stand for LGBT Americans.

Here is the latest: No openly-gay Americans were appointed to Cabinet-level positions, though openly anti-gay person with only a horrible LGBT voting record was selected, Senator Judd Gregg.

By ignoring Gregg's horrible record on gay civil rights, he's in part excusing it and condoning it. And that's not the kind of change we need.

Update: Gregg has since rejected Obama's invitation, citing differences with his economic policies. Let's hope Obama puts forward a better choice.
